Output 39338b80cc9012017ab49cbcc5ebd43fb7a884d59a3e3a99bc87e1144e6ff709:0

value
236417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89fc7e35463bebcf66c1daa68acb88a11824ca07 OP_EQUAL
address
3EGcyM1MCxpEy8AAW4UEtiysYsn5kNnGXY
transaction
39338b80cc9012017ab49cbcc5ebd43fb7a884d59a3e3a99bc87e1144e6ff709
confirmations
550800
spent
true